Williams Bay, Wisconsin, in Walworth county, is 25 miles E of Janesville, Wisconsin (center to center) and 45 miles SW of Milwaukee, Wisconsin. The village has a population of 2,415.
In Williams Bay, about 59% of adults are married.
In 2000, Williams Bay had a median family income of $60,573. Williams Bay is full of successful families and individuals. The village benefits from its educated workforce. Williams Bay, compared to most villages like it, can boast of a large population of high-income unmarried people.
In the 2004 Presidential fund-raising sweepstakes, George W. Bush came out ahead among Williams Bay residents, with $5,450. Residents gave more to the Republican party than any of the others.
In Williams Bay, 74% of the houses and apartments are occupied by the owners, not rented out. The village sports a large amount of seasonal housing, typically for vacation or part-time use. Williams Bay has higher property taxes than most places in Wisconsin, which provides more money for local schools and services.
In Williams Bay, 93% of commuters drive to work. If gasoline prices keep going up, consider living in villages like Williams Bay; a good number of people there walk and bicycle to work. Why drive when you can avoid it? People in Williams Bay use public transportation more than most people in similar villages.
